2025-06-11
15th Riigikogu, 5th session, plenary sitting
The political stance is strongly focused on protecting national security and sovereignty, supporting the severing of ties with the Moscow Patriarchate. Simultaneously, the speaker emphasizes the principles of the rule of law and the necessity of streamlining the Estonian legal framework in accordance with the rulings of the Supreme Court and the European Court of Justice (specifically referencing the Aliens Act). Their approach is a blend of a value-based framework (the defense of independence) and a political framework (the harmonization of legislation).

2025-06-04
15th Riigikogu, 5th session, plenary session
The most prominent theme is the strengthening of oversight regarding party financing, which the speaker believes is an acute problem requiring immediate resolution. He expresses personal dissatisfaction with the practices that have recently come to light, stressing the necessity of rectifying the situation. This indicates a strong focus on policy and tangible results. Although the commission proposed rejecting the specific draft legislation, the speaker broadly supports the necessity of reform.
2025-06-03
Fifteenth Riigikogu, fifth session, plenary session
The political position is generally supportive of the minister's optimistic plan but raises three detailed areas of concern regarding infrastructure, water reform, and waste management reform. Support is given to stimulating the economy through large-scale infrastructure development, and emphasis is placed on a comprehensive and intelligently focused approach to road construction. Criticism is directed at the methodology used to implement the reforms and market inefficiencies, particularly within the producer responsibility system. The political framework is clearly policy-driven and focused on performance and results.
